Latest Patents
Welshans holds a patent for the McCulloh receiver. This device is designed to connect to a McCulloh loop, featuring both an N or line side and a G or ground side. The receiver is capable of receiving coded alarm signals from multiple McCulloh transmitters. It is specifically adapted to supply these alarm signals to a computer, ensuring that the output signal polarity remains consistent regardless of the input signal polarity. Additionally, the receiver includes an inhibit circuit to prevent the G process logic circuit from sending output to the computer unless a fault condition occurs in the McCulloh loop. It also features a fault sensing circuit and a sampling circuit to test the McCulloh loop during fault conditions.
